Magnetic bipartition feasible, safe and effective in achieving incisionless, suture/staple-free duodeno-ileostomy
An innovative technique using a biofragmentable magnetic anastomosis system (BMAS) to effect magnetic duodeno-ileostomy (MagDI) bipartition, could be a promising minimally invasive option for patients with mild obesity and T2DM, according to the outcomes for a first-in-human investigation, led by Professor Michel Gagner, an innovator in the development of laparoscopic sleeve gastrectomy and magnetic anastomosis from Westmount Square Surgical Cen…
